OverviewA stunning and news-making biography detailing how America's Mayor, once beloved around the world, became a tragic figure, and the driving force behind Donald Trump's biggest scandals.Rudy Giuliani was the legendary prosecutor of Mafia bosses, corrupt politicians, and white-collar criminals. As mayor of New York City, he gained fame for conquering its crime problem and engineering a remarkable turnaround, garnering acclaim but also condemnation for his ruthless tactics, and a never-ending stream of marital scandals. He led the city through the September 11th attacks on the World Trade Center, earning worldwide respect for his compassionate leadership, and the title of America's Mayor. To much criticism, he parlayed that fame into stratospheric wealth, founding a consulting business catering to companies and foreign governments eager to associate with an international hero. In 2008, he ran for president, only to watch his White House ambitions collapse in a disastrous campaign. After struggling to reclaim his stature, and searching for business in shadowy corners of the world, he found his new calling in Donald Trump's presidential effort, beginning reluctantly but growing into his most loyal defender. After Trump's victory in 2016, Giuliani's increasingly erratic behavior sparked widespread ridicule, and he became the driving force behind scandals that led Trump to be impeached twice. He was widely derided for his sometimes comic efforts to prove election fraud in the 2020 campaign. By the end of Trump's presidency he was broke, his once-sterling reputation tarnished beyond recognition. In this revealing biography, Andrew Kirtzman pieces together Giuliani's rise and fall from hundreds of interviews with friends, family members, White House officials, business partners, and close confidants, some of whom have never gone on the record before. He reveals new information about Giuliani's role in the 2020 election debacle, his relationship with Trump, his troubled personal life, and much more. Giuliani contains explosive revelations, and answers the question that everyone has asked: What happened to Rudy Giuliani? Table of ContentsReviewsAuthor InformationAndrew Kirtzman has covered Rudy Giuliani for three decades as a political reporter for print and television. He began as a City Hall reporter and then wrote what is considered a definitive book about Giuliani's mayoralty. He was with Giuliani on the morning of September 11th, and chronicled their experience together. He has covered more than a dozen national political campaigns, and hosted two of New York's most widely watched political shows, winning multiple Emmy Awards. He has written for The New York Times, The Washington Post, The New Republic, and other publications, and authored a book about the Bernie Madoff scandal. He appears regularly on CNN and MSNBC to discuss politics and government.
